With the mighty Mississippi River as the backdrop for most of the concerts and the added bonus of the Memphis cityscape for others, "Soulin' on the River" is a sample of the new sound of Memphis soul featuring five great bands June-August in The Grove on Mud Island, Renaissance Park (South Memphis), The Heights (Treadwell) and Overton Park (Midtown)!
FEATURED ARTIST: Jordan Occasionally
Jordan Occasionally, or JD, is a neo soul and R&B artist, born and raised in the soul capital of music, Memphis, TN. She has been a performer since she was four years old and picked up songwriting around the age of fifteen. Jordan Occasionally has been featured in articles in The Daily Memphian, Choose 901, and the Commercial Appeal for her self-released EP “1998.” Inspired by the freedom fighters of the past, Jordan Occasionally writes her music with the hopes of empowering generations before and after her that they are never too old or young to recognize how their roots can change the world.
